Dr Pieter Pauw (1984) currently works for the FS-UNEP Center at the Frankfurt School of Finance and Management, where he conducts research and provides policy advice on international climate policy and climate finance. Before joining the FS-UNEP Center, Pieter worked at the German Development Institute / Deutsches Institut für Entwicklungspolitik (DIE) in Bonn, where his research focused more on adaptation in developing countries, climate justice issues and Nationally Determined Contributions. Pauw is an Associate at Stockholm Environment Institute and the Utrecht University. Pieter also worked at the German Federal Ministry for Economic Cooperation and Development (BMZ), the Institute for Environmental Studies (IVM) in Amsterdam and he was active as a consultant.

Pieter did projects in countries including the Netherlands, Ghana, Kenya, Botswana, Cameroon and Zambia, for eg UNEP Finance Initiative, the Dutch Ministry of Foreign affairs, the Dutch province of Overijssel, the World Bank, WWF, the OECD and the German Federal Ministry for Economic Cooperation and Development.

He published numerous scientific papers, book chapters, reports and op-eds and is a contributing author to the IPCC's fifth assessment report. Over the last couple of years, Pauw presented his work over a 100 times at (international) conferences, workshops and for broader audiences. Pieter likes to moderate events as well, and gives interviews to media occasionally.

Pieter Pauw successfully defended his PhD at the Copernicus Institute of Sustainable Development (Utrecht University) in 2017 and finalized his MSc in 'Environment and Resource Management' at the VU University in Amsterdam (2008).
